The Importance of Headlight Brightness
The primary function of a motorcycle's headlight is to illuminate the road ahead, ensuring that riders can see clearly in various lighting conditions. Whether you're riding during the day, at night, or in adverse weather, a bright headlight is essential for detecting obstacles, pedestrians, and other vehicles. It also enhances your visibility to other road users, reducing the risk of accidents.

Factors Affecting Headlight Brightness
Several factors can influence the brightness of an adult electric motorcycle's headlight. Understanding these factors can help you choose the right headlight for your bike and ensure optimal performance.
1. Bulb Type
The type of bulb used in the headlight plays a significant role in determining its brightness. There are several types of bulbs available, including halogen, LED, and HID (High-Intensity Discharge) bulbs.
- Halogen Bulbs: These are the most common type of bulbs used in motorcycles. They are relatively inexpensive and provide a warm, yellowish light. However, they are not as bright as LED or HID bulbs and have a shorter lifespan.
- LED Bulbs: LED (Light Emitting Diode) bulbs are becoming increasingly popular in the motorcycle industry due to their energy efficiency, long lifespan, and high brightness. They produce a bright, white light that is similar to daylight, making them ideal for night riding.
- HID Bulbs: HID bulbs are known for their high brightness and long-range illumination. They produce a bright, blue-white light that can significantly improve visibility on the road. However, they are more expensive than halogen and LED bulbs and require a special ballast to operate.
2. Power Output
The power output of the headlight is another important factor that affects its brightness. The higher the wattage of the bulb, the brighter the light it produces. However, it's important to note that higher wattage bulbs also consume more energy, which can drain the motorcycle's battery faster.
3. Reflector Design
The design of the headlight reflector can also impact its brightness. A well-designed reflector can focus the light in a specific direction, increasing the intensity and range of the beam. Some reflectors are designed to produce a wide, spread-out beam, while others are designed to produce a narrow, focused beam.
4. Lens Quality
The quality of the headlight lens can also affect the brightness of the light. A clear, scratch-free lens will allow more light to pass through, resulting in a brighter beam. On the other hand, a dirty or scratched lens can reduce the brightness and clarity of the light.
Ideal Headlight Brightness for Adult Electric Motorcycles
The ideal headlight brightness for an adult electric motorcycle depends on several factors, including the riding conditions, the type of motorcycle, and personal preferences. However, as a general rule, a headlight should provide a minimum of 1,000 lumens of light for safe night riding.
For urban riding, a headlight with a brightness of 1,000 to 2,000 lumens is usually sufficient. This will provide enough light to see clearly in well-lit areas and help you avoid obstacles. For rural or off-road riding, a headlight with a brightness of 2,000 to 3,000 lumens is recommended. This will provide more light for better visibility in dark or poorly lit areas.


It's important to note that the brightness of the headlight is not the only factor that affects visibility. The color temperature of the light, the beam pattern, and the angle of the headlight also play a role in determining how well you can see on the road.
